Miscellaneous Information for Fairview ...

The Federal government has assigned various identifying codes to each community, county and state. At one time or another, the US Census Bureau has used one (or more) of the following identifiers when referring to either Clayton County or the community of Fairview:

  • The GNIS Codes ...
    • The current system of identification is called the Geographic Names Information System (GNIS). The following GNIS codes relate to Fairview:
    • GNIS ID for Fairview: 456477
    • GNIS ID for Clayton County: 465210
    • GNIS ID for State of Iowa: 1779785
  • The FIPS Codes ...
    • An earlier (and largely obsolete) identification method was called the Federal Information Processing Standard (FIPS):
    • State Code: 19 (Iowa)
    • County Code: 043 (Clayton County)
    • Place Code: 26615 (Fairview)
    • State & County Code: 19/043 (Iowa / Clayton County)
    • State & Place Code: 19/26615 (Iowa / Fairview)
  • Misc. Census Codes ...
    • Fairview is located in Census Region #2 (the Midwest Region) and Division #4 (the West North-Central Division).
